The OSG 404-3125-BN is a solid carbide ball end mill designed for precision milling operations across a wide range of workpiece materials. With a 0.3125-inch mill diameter, 0.8125-inch length of cut, and a 4-flute helical geometry at a 30-degree helix angle, this tool delivers reliable performance on both roughing and finishing passes. The micrograin carbide construction provides the hardness and wear resistance required for consistent tolerancing at production volumes. The bright uncoated finish suits applications where coating interaction with the workpiece is a concern. Machinists and tool-and-die professionals will find this end mill well suited to general-purpose CNC and manual milling work.
The 404-3125-BN belongs to OSG Series 404BN, a standard carbide end mill lineup built to consistent quality tolerances. It is suited for use on steel, stainless steel, cast iron, non-ferrous metals, superalloys, titanium, and hard materials. The straight-cylindrical shank fits standard collet and end mill holders. With a 2.5-inch overall length and standard length classification, this tool fits typical milling setups without requiring extended-reach tooling. It is a single-end tool intended for right-hand cutting and right-hand flute direction.
Rated for use on steel, stainless steel, cast iron, non-ferrous metal, superalloys, titanium, and hard materials per ISO material codes P, M, K, N, S, and H. Fits standard 5/16-inch collets and end mill holders with a straight-cylindrical shank interface.
Installation is performed by machinists or CNC setup technicians using a properly sized collet or end mill holder torqued to the machine spindle specification. Ensure the spindle is fully powered down and locked out before changing tooling. Confirm runout at the tool tip with a dial indicator before beginning a production run, as excessive runout accelerates wear and degrades surface finish. Do not exceed the recommended depth of cut or feed rate for the workpiece material and machine rigidity.
